It's a shame what happened to the 550 that was in the GT class. It looked like he hit the wall a ton. Awesome coverage on the Speed Channel...in one segment they showed the differences between the Prodrive and the Rafanelli 550 Maranellos. The largest one is that Prodrive has a 6 litre V12, but the Olive Garden Ferrari was only able to bore theirs out to 5.7 or 5.8 litres. Next year they'll get the same engine though. The rest of the differences were in aerodynamics as the Prodrive car has spent more time in the wind tunnel. Good times, good times... |
